CO3 0QE is a small residential postcode area in Essex, situated approximately 3 miles west of Colchester city centre. It lies at the junction of the A12 and A1124 roads, near Eight Ash Green, and is part of the Colchester built-up area. Historically a village, Stanway has evolved into a suburban extension of Colchester, with a population of 1,612 residents. The area is well-connected to the city via major roads and rail links, making it accessible for commuters. Local landmarks include Colchester Zoo, a popular attraction, and Stanway School, which serves the community. The area’s proximity to Colchester offers easy access to urban amenities while retaining a quieter, residential character. With a median age of 47, the community is predominantly composed of middle-aged and older adults, reflecting a settled, stable demographic. Living here means balancing suburban tranquillity with the convenience of nearby city services, making it appealing to those seeking a compromise between rural and urban living.
